Love These Boots

High quality product and excellent fit. Can be tough to find an affordable hiking shoe in wide width so was pleased when I realized Merrell, a quality brand, offered a wide fit option. Very comfortable, even after a long day’s hike. Purchased for a four month trip to Europe and they are still as comfortable after 4 months as the first day. Thick soles with great grip/traction. The only negative is they are bulky so they took up a lot of space in luggage. Regardless, I would definitely buy again. Read more

Second Pair – Proven Durability & Comfort After Break-In

This is my second pair of Merrell Moabs. My first pair was the Moab 2, and they lasted me 5 years before I finally decided to replace them — which says a lot about the durability. Because of that experience, I didn’t hesitate to go with the Moab 3 Low. Out of the box, they felt supportive and well-built, but they really started to shine after a few days of wear. The sole gradually molded to my foot and became noticeably more comfortable, so there is definitely a short break-in period — but it’s completely normal and worth it. One quick tip: at first I noticed a little rubbing from the laces across the top of my foot. I realized it was just from uneven tension when I laced them up. Once I tightened the laces evenly from bottom to top, the issue completely went away. Take a second to lace them properly when you put them on and you shouldn’t have any problems. They’re stable, supportive, and feel durable — great for everyday wear and light hiking. Based on my experience with both the Moab 2 and now the Moab 3, I’d absolutely buy them again. Read more
